There are ways through which you can see the Infotypes data maintained for a PERNR:

1. Go to PA10 and put the PERNR and press display button. After pressing the display button it would first display the Infotype data (e.g Infotype 0000 data), and the by clicking the next button you can view all the infotypes maintained for that PERNR.

2. Go to T-code PU00 . This is to delete the PA data, But if on the initial screen you put the PERNR and hit execute button, it would not delete the data, rather it would show you the list of Infotypes maintained for the PERNR .
